Hey folks — handing off LiftPath release duties to Mara while I'm out. The elevator-dispatch simulator ships Thursdays; build 4.2 is staged and the scenario packs are frozen. Only gotcha: the dispatch-core artifact won't promote unless it's signed before the smoke suite kicks off, so do that first, not after. Everything else is in the runbook on the Ostermill wiki. Mara, you'll need the deploy key to push to the release channel, so pasting it here for the sync notes.

deploy key for tawip-bawig: bky13_1zSxDtVxnNkjh

Hey, quick handover on the Mossvale wiki RBAC stuff before I roll off. Roles are defined in the admin panel under Groups — don't edit the YAML directly, it gets regenerated nightly. The "Archivist" role is the weird one; it grants page deletion, so keep membership tiny. If you ever get locked out of the admin account, there's a recovery flow, and it asks for the passphrase below.

vault phrase of tawig-taduf = zorath-oliwyn

## Break-glass access — Variantly assignment service

If the Variantly experiment assignment service fails during a release and the normal admin console is unreachable, the release manager may invoke break-glass access. This bypasses SSO and grants direct write access to the bucketing config, so use it only when assignments are actively misrouting traffic. All break-glass sessions are logged and reviewed within 24 hours. To open the sealed break-glass credentials bundle, you will need the recovery passphrase that follows.

vault phrase of bafop-kahop = sormir-frador

## Break-Glass: Incremental Rebuilds on Stonebright

If the incremental static rebuild pipeline wedges and the publish queue backs up, break-glass access lets you force a full rebuild. Only use this when partial rebuilds loop or emit stale pages. Steps: pause the queue, clear the dependency graph cache, trigger full-rebuild from the Stonebright console. Expect 40 minutes. Log the incident in the maintainers channel afterward. The break-glass console prompt requires the recovery passphrase below.

recovery phrase for fajep-yaweg: gilath-sorox-wenius-rusdor-keliel-zorius